rfc6891 states that it uses TCP to avoid truncated UDP responses. It is all 
about packet size,fragmentation and network load.

 

EDNS(0) specifies a way to advertise additional features such as

   larger response size capability, which is intended to help avoid

   truncated UDP responses, which in turn cause retry over TCP.  It

   therefore provides support for transporting these larger packet sizes

   without needing to resort to TCP for transport.

 

Announcing UDP buffer sizes that are too small may result in fallback

   to TCP with a corresponding load impact on DNS servers.  This is

   especially important with DNSSEC, where answers are much larger.
